Namespace Aspose.Svg.ImageVectorization

Namespace Aspose.Svg.ImageVectorization

Classes

Klasse navnDescription
BezierPathBuilderDen Aspose.Svg.ImageVectorization.BezierPathBuilder klasse er ansvarlig for at konstruere en Bezier vej fra et givet sæt point. Det nærmer en spor af punkter med en bezier kurve, optimerer antallet af segmenter til tæt at matche den oprindelige spor samtidig med at minimere kompleksiteten.
ImageTraceSimplifierImageTraceSimplifier-klassen er ansvarlig for at reducere antallet af point i en kurve, der er nærmet af en række sporpunkter.
ImageTraceSmootherImageTraceSimplifier-klassen er ansvarlig for at blødgøre antallet af punkter i en kurve, der er nærmet af en række sporpunkter.
ImageVectorizerDenne ImageVectorizer-klasse vektoriserer rasterbilleder som PNG, JPG, GIF, BMP osv. og returnerer SVGDocument. Under vectorisering indebærer vi processen med at reducere bitmaps til geometriske former lavet af vejelementer og gemt som SVG.
ImageVectorizerConfigurationDen Aspose.Svg.ImageVectorization.ImagevectorizerConfiguration klasse definerer en konfiguration af billedvektorisering metoder og muligheder.
SplinePathBuilderDen Aspose.Svg.ImageVectorization.PathBuilder klasse er designet til at konstruere en glat vej ved at omdanne Centripetal Catmull-Rom spliner til Bezier kurver. Det tilbyder en metode for at skabe en vej, der smidigt interpolerer gennem et sæt punkter, hvilket giver en balance mellem loyalitet til punkterne og gyldighed af kurven.
StencilConfigurationAspose.svg.ImageVectorization.StencilConfiguration klasse definerer en konfiguration af stencil effekt muligheder.

Interfaces

Interface navnDescription
IImageTraceSimplifierDen IImageTraceSimplifier-grænseflade er ansvarlig for at reducere punkterne i sporet.
IImageTraceSmootherDen IImageTraceSmoother-grænseflade er ansvarlig for glidende spor.
IPathBuilderIPathBuilder-grænsefladen er ansvarlig for at bygge vejsegmenter Aspose.Svg.Paths.VGPathSeg fra listen over sporpunkter.

Enums

Enum navnDescription
StencilTypeAspose.svg.ImageVectorization.StencilType enum definerer stenciltyper.
 Dansk